FormaLms
FormaLms

Description: FormaLms is an open-source Learning Management System built in PHP using Laravel framework. It allows businesses, schools and universities to create, deliver, and track online courses and training programs. Key features include course authoring tools, assessments, certificates, gamification, and analytics.

Litmos
Litmos

Description: Litmos is a cloud-based learning management system (LMS) designed for mid-market corporate training. It allows companies to create, deliver, and track online training courses and programs. Key features include course authoring tools, SCORM compliance, automated notifications and reminders, mobile compatibility, analytics and reports, gamification options, and integration with other systems like Salesforce and Slack.

Pros & Cons Analysis

FormaLms
FormaLms
Pros
  • Free and open source
  • Customizable and extensible
  • Good course authoring capabilities
  • Supports gamification and badges
  • Active community support
Cons
  • Less polished UI than some commercial LMSs
  • Limited native integrations compared to commercial options
  • May require more technical expertise to customize and maintain
Litmos
Litmos
Pros
  • Intuitive and easy to use interface
  • Robust reporting and analytics
  • Mobile access and offline sync
  • Custom branding options
  • SCORM and xAPI compliance
  • Integration with other platforms
Cons
  • Can be pricey for small businesses
  • Limited customizability for branding
  • Steep learning curve for some advanced features
  • No native virtual classroom capabilities
  • Limited language support
